Warriors’ Game 7 has largest cable TV audience for NBA game

Ponca City Now - June 1, 2016 11:29 am

ATLANTA (AP) – The Warriors’ Game 7 win to complete a comeback from down 3-1 in the Western Conference finals has drawn the largest TV audience for an NBA game on cable.

The defending champs’ 96-88 come-from-behind victory over the Thunder on Monday night on TNT averaged 15.9 million viewers. The network said Tuesday that’s the most-watched telecast of any kind in TNT’s 28-year history.

It was the largest audience for any pre-NBA Finals game since Game 7 of the 2000 Western Conference finals between the Lakers and Trail Blazers.
